ASSET MANAGEMENT company Schroders has announced the appointment of chartered accountant Ashley Almanza to its board.
Almanza was appointed chief financial officer of the BG Group, the successor to British Gas in 2002, until March this year. Between 2009 and 2010, he was also managing director, UK, Europe and Central Asia. He held the position of chairman of the Hundred Group of Finance Directors between 2007 and 2010.

Almanza will also serve as a member of the nominations committee and the audit and risk committee.
Michael Miles, chairman of Schroders, said: "We are delighted that Ashley is joining Schroders as a Non-executive director. His experience as chief financial officer of a major listed company will further strengthen the board and the audit and risk committee and I look forward to his contribution."
